Has anybody else managed to get BGP with MD5 passwords (Cisco style) working?
From what I can see this problem was brought up a while ago and dismissed as a FreeBSD problem. I've also noticed similar messages pop up with IPSEC tunnels (likely due to the same problem) which makes me wonder why this hasn't been looked at ???This is the error I get:
bgpd[xxxx]: no kernel support for PF_KEY
Surely this shouldn't be a problem still. It seems it can be fixed by recompiling the kernel with the TCP_SIGNATURE option. Can anyone confirm a working md5-password setup with the OpenBGPD on PfSense 2.0.1?
Is this using the GUI form to input the key or manually configured? I've tried the GUI, editing the config manually, running the OpenBGPD daemon manually and also manually using "setkey" to create the keys just in case. Something to note, is whenever OpenBGPD is initialised, in the logs it says "pfkey not available".
Other than that, I'm still getting "pfkey setup failed" errors when trying to connect. In this case it's my PfSense box connecting to a Juniper router via a PPPOE connection with multihop (BGP router is 2 hops). There are no routing problems as ping to the BGP neighbor is fine and I've confirmed the password to be sure.
Everything I can find on the net (and there's very little) suggests the kernel module problem as linked.
Also, if I do a "sysctl -a" the "net.inet.tcp.signature_verify_input=0" setting regarding the PFKey module and TCP MD5 connections is missing.
I've currently setup the PfSense Development OVA and will recompile the whole lot with the PFKey module in to test. Needless to say, it will take a while though. This could probably fix the IPSEC errors which are dependant on PFKEY as well.Also, the OpenBGPD package doesn't log anywhere. I setup a manual "all.log" file in the syslogd.conf to capture bgpd info (setting gets wiped on reboot though). This should probably be added so that it logs to system.log.
